So far the best place we can find for price and selection is Top Choice in Hamrun.  They have a website to google

So far nearly every electrical appliance we have bought in three years here has been cheaper than UK.
We have bought :
40 " smart TV for 399 euros (£280)
Halogen oven for 60 euros (£42)
Electric Kettle for 25 euros (£17)
Steam Generator  Iron for 120 euros (£84)

Just last week in one of the flyers that came round was a fridge with small freezer compartment for 170 euros and most places have micro waves from around 90 euros

I don't think that is expensive!

Try to buy from Oxford House in Mriehel industrial estate in the main road - good products with good prices and long guarantees.  Top choice in Hamrun is good as well.

Another good place to shop is Vitel in San Gwann. Tiny store but he gets most brands and gives good advice. He has a very good reputation among locals.

There is always JB Stores in Fgura, San Gwann, St.Pauls Bay and Hamrun they sell mostly everthing and reasonable and of course on the cheaper side Tallera
